Home » Nevada » Las Vegas » Sunset Affiliated Hotels » Map

Sunset Affiliated Hotels Location Map

Sunset Affiliated Hotels is located at 629 S Main St, Las Vegas, NV-89101. An interactive Map of Sunset Affiliated Hotels is shown below.

View details of Sunset Affiliated Hotels.